Rat care has rapidly changed over the course of the last twenty-five years. In fact, some of the information I learned when I started owning rats in 2019 is considered outdated due to the rapidly-developing exotic pet veterinary research. Discrepancies and misconceptions run rampant in the pet rat community, and as a result I sought out to provide open-access information surrounding rat care that is backed by scientific literature, but placed in language that is easily understood by the general public.
I have spent the last two years compiling sources and information, and through the help of the community I have been able to compile a library of real-life photos, videos, and media to provide an (almost) all-encompassing collection for rat owners and professionals alike.
